Dark blood red/purple in color. This is not a mindblowing wine, but it's solidly constructed. Copious amounts of firm silky tannins. This really isn't showing the typical Foley youthful forwardness that many of his wines do. Notes of briary blackberry, bitter chocolate, espresso grounds, vanilla bean, and lots of toasty oak. Full bodied with a moderate/long finish full of silky, dusty tannin. This needs some time. 94+ pts.

I had it also a week or so back and too found it a little tighter than usual for Foley. I drank to 03 right after it was released and it seemed much more approachable. On the 04 there didn't seem to be as much upfront crushed berry fruit and the vanilla bean really came through on the silky finish. I though it was a great wine but needed a little time (95+).
